Explanation

For the enforcement of a foreign award, it is necessary that the award has been made by the arbitral tribunal provided for in the submission to arbitration or constituted in the manner or agreed upon by the parties and in conformity with the law governing the arbitration procedure, or the enforcement of the award is not contrary to the public policy or the law of India.
